Gold Tops US$5,000 Per Ounce First Time Ever


Sharjah: Gold prices reached a record high on Sunday, with the price per ounce surpassing the $5,000 threshold. Gold was trading at US$5,026 per ounce, while silver prices had reached US$100 on Friday for the first time in history.



According to Emirates News Agency, this unprecedented surge in gold prices is attributed to increased demand from investors seeking safe-haven assets amidst global economic uncertainties. The rise in silver prices also indicates a significant shift in market dynamics as investors diversify their portfolios.
